码迷,mamicode.com
首页 > 数据库 > 详细

启动/关闭oracle服务有三种方式

时间:2015-07-02 11:42:52      阅读:162      评论:0      收藏:0      [点我收藏+]

标签:

启动oracle服务有三种方式:?
1 从控制面板?
2 使用MS-DOS命令?
3 通过Oracle Administration Assistant for WindowsNT

-通过控制面板启动oracle服务?
1)选择开始 > 控制面板 〉管理工具 --〉服务?
2)找到你所要启动的oracle服务,单击启动

-通过MS-DOS命令启动oracle服务?
1)打开DOS窗口?
2)在窗口中输入:NET START OracleServiceName

-通过Oracle Administration Assistant for WindowsNT启动oracle服务

1)选择开始 〉程序 〉Oracle - HOME_NAME > Configuration and Migration?
Tools > Oracle Administration Assistant for Windows NT.?
2)找到并右键单击oracle sid?
3)选择启动

? ?

关闭oracle服务同样也有三种方式:?
1 从控制面板?
2 使用MS-DOS命令?
3 通过Oracle Administration Assistant for WindowsNT

-通过控制面板关闭oracle服务?
1)选择开始 > 控制面板 〉管理工具 --〉服务?
2)找到你所要启动的oracle服务,单击停止

-通过MS-DOS命令关闭oracle服务?
1)打开DOS窗口?
2)在窗口中输入:NET STOP OracleServiceName

-通过Oracle Administration Assistant for WindowsNT关闭oracle服务

1)选择开始 〉程序 〉Oracle - HOME_NAME > Configuration and Migration?
Tools > Oracle Administration Assistant for Windows NT.?
2)找到并右键单击oracle sid?
3)选择停止

? ?

快速启动Sqlplus的方式:

在开始菜单下,单击"运行"输入:?
??? sqlplusw? /nolog? 或者sqlplusw user/password

启动/关闭数据库 :startup/shutdown

启动/关闭侦听器:lsnrctl start /lsnrctl stop

?

批处理 启动和关闭 Oracle 11g 服务

启动和关闭数据库所使用的服务器名称和说明:
服务名称??????????????????????????????????????????????????? 说明
OracleOracle_homeTNSListener?????????? 对应于数据库的监听程序
OracleServiceSID?????????????????????????????????????? 对应于数据库的例程
OracleDBConsoleSID???????????????????????????????? 对应于Oracle Enterprise Manager(OEM)

其中,Oracle_home表示Oracle主目录,如Oracle11g_home1;SID表示Oracle系统标识符,如OracleServiceORCL的ORCL。

注意:尽管这3个服务都是可以单独地启动和关闭的,但它们之间不像Oracle 10g 中那样没有依存关系。

比较好的启动顺序是:OracleOracle_homeTNSListener,OracleServiceSID,OracleDBConsoleSID。关闭时次序相反。

下面给出了已经排好顺序的启动和停止服务的两个批处理文件:

Start Oracle 11g Service.bat

@echo off

echo?确定要启动Oracle 11g服务吗?

pause

net start OracleOraDb11g_home1TNSListener

net start OracleServiceORCL

net start OracleDBConsoleorcl

echo?启动Oracle 11g服务完成,请确认有没有错误发生。

Pause

?

Stop Oracle 11g Service.bat

@echo off

echo?确定要停止Oracle 11g服务吗?

pause

net stop OracleDBConsoleorcl

net stop OracleServiceORCL

net stop OracleOraDb11g_home1TNSListener

echo?停止Oracle 11g服务完成,请确认有没有错误发生。

Pause

启动/关闭oracle服务有三种方式

标签:

原文地址:http://www.cnblogs.com/mellowsmile/p/4615216.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!